Understanding the differences between web directories and search engines is vital for maximizing your online resources. Both serve distinctive purposes, and recognizing their functions can enhance your navigation strategy.
Web directories are platforms where websites are categorized based on specific topics. Users can browse through categories to find relevant sites.
Search engines like Google index the web and return results based on user queries, employing complex algorithms to match content with search terms.
1. Content Organization: Web directories rely on human curation, while search engines generate results based on algorithms.
2. User Interaction: Directories often allow users to submit their websites for inclusion, while search engines primarily focus on indexing existing sites.
3. Content Freshness: Search engine results are constantly updated, while web directories may not reflect the most current content.
4. Search Capability: Search engines provide more robust search capabilities and often return a wider variety of results.
While web directories and search engines serve different functions, both can be valuable resources when used appropriately. Understanding their differences helps users navigate the web more effectively.
